Chapter 27 118 Shi Le Reading Han Shu

In the second year after Emperor Jin Yuan ascended the throne, Liu Cong, the ruler of the Han Kingdom of the Huns, died of illness.There were also divisions within Han.Liu Cong's nephew Liu Yao took over the position of king.He felt that using the name of the Han Dynasty could not deceive the people, so in 319 AD, he changed the name of the country to Zhao.Shi Le, a general of the Han Dynasty, expanded his military strength in the anti-Jin war, and he did not want to be ruled by Liu Yao anymore, so he also called himself King Zhao. Shi Le is a member of the Jie tribe, and his family has been the little leader of the Jie tribe for generations.When he was young, there was a famine in Bingzhou, and he was separated from the tribe. He used to be a slave and servant for others.Once, Shi Le was captured by rebels and locked in a prison cart.It happened that a herd of deer ran by beside his prison car.The rebels went after the deer one after another, and Shi Le took the opportunity to escape.

Shi Le suffered so much and had no way out, so he recruited a group of exiled peasants to form a strong team.After Liu Yuan raised an army, Shi Le surrendered to Han and became a general under Liu Yuan. The culture of the Jie people is lower than that of the Huns.Shi Le was not educated in Han culture like Liu Yuan was, and was illiterate.After he served as a general, he gradually realized that to achieve a great cause, force alone cannot be used. He relied on Zhang Bin, a Han scholar, and took many political measures.He also took in a group of poor scholars from the Han nationality in the north, and organized a "Gentlemen's Camp".

Because Shi Le was brave and good at fighting, and Zhang Bin had a group of counselors to help him make suggestions, Shi Le's power became stronger.In 328 AD, Liu Yao was finally eliminated.Two years later, Shi Le proclaimed himself emperor in the state of Xiang, and the name of the state was still Zhao.Historically, Liu's State of Zhao was called "Former Zhao", and the State of Zhao established by Shi Le was called "Later Zhao". Shi Le himself has no culture, but he attaches great importance to scholars.After he became Emperor Zhao, he ordered his subordinates not to kill any scholars who were caught, but to send them to Xiangguo for him to deal with.

He followed Zhang Bin's advice and set up a school, and asked the children of his generals to study in the school.He also established a system of recommendation and examination.All the people recommended from all over the country passed the evaluation and were selected as officials. Shi Le strictly forbids his subordinates to mention the characters "Hu" and "Jie".But in order to appease the Han scholars, sometimes the ban was not enforced. Once, Fan Tan, a Han official, was appointed as an official.When Fan Tan entered the palace for an audience, he was wearing tattered clothes.Shi Le asked him in surprise, "How come you are so poor?"

Fan Tan forgot about the prohibition, and replied, "I just met a group of Jie thieves who robbed me of all my belongings. I don't even have a decent piece of clothing at home." Shi Le knew that he had suffered a loss, so he comforted him and said, "It's not right for Jie thieves to rob things like this! I will compensate them for them!" Fan Tan suddenly remembered that he violated the prohibition order, and trembling with fright, he hurriedly asked Shi Le for his crime. Shi Le smiled and said, "My ban is for ordinary people. You old scholars, I don't blame you."

As he said, he really gave Fan Tan some clothes and money, and also rewarded him with a car and a horse. Shi Le likes reading very much.He was illiterate himself, so he asked some scholars to tell him the book, and while listening, he also expressed his opinions at any time. Once, he had someone read the "Book of Han" to him, and heard someone persuade Han Gaozu to enshrine the history of the descendants of the nobles of the old six countries.He said: "Ah! Liu Bang took such a wrong approach, how can he win the world?" The speaker immediately explained to him, but because of Zhang Liang's dissuasion, Han Gaozu did not do this.Shi Le nodded and said, "That's right."

Another time, Shi Le held a banquet for ministers. At the banquet, he asked a minister, "What kind of ancient emperors do you think I can compare with?" The minister boasted: "Your Majesty is wise and powerful, stronger than Han Gaozu, and no one else can compare." Shi Le smiled and said: "You are talking too much. If I meet Han Gaozu, I can only be his servant, probably similar to Han Xin and Peng Yue. If I was born at the time of Emperor Guangwu of the Han Dynasty, I could keep pace with him , It’s still not clear who wins and who loses.” Due to Shile's reuse of talents, he was relatively enlightened politically, and prosperity appeared in the early days of the Later Zhao Dynasty.
